THE NW MN CANCER CRUSADERS WILL HOST EASTER EGG SCRAMBLE AND RAFFLE ON SATURDAY

The Northwest Minnesota Cancer Crusaders will host an Easter Egg Scramble and Vendor Fair at the Crookston Sports Center on Saturday, March 30 from 10:00 a.m. to Noon. POLK COUNTY SHERIFF’S OFFICE ARRESTS TWO SUSPECTS IN BURGLARY

On Wednesday, March 27 at 5:53 a.m. the Polk County Sheriff’s Office received a call for service regarding a possible burglary in progress in Belgium Township. Upon arrival, Deputies discovered that the suspects fled the area on foot. After an extensive search of the area, 29-year-old Robert Fred Fish of Warren was located and arrested.

PIRATE SPEECH TEAM ADVANCES FOUR TO SECTION COMPETITION

The Crookston High School Speech team competed in the Subsection 30A tournament at Dilworth-Glyndon-Felton High School in Glyndon on Tuesday, with four students advancing to sections.
